About the Role

AWX is seeking Aerial Support Officers for the Department of Primary Industries (DPI) to support with invasive species data collection and recording, including fire ant density data, and to support logistical aspects of the project such as supplying treatment products to project partners and contractors. In support of the National Fire Ant Eradication Program (NFAEP), the Queensland Government funded the Fire Ant Suppression Taskforce (FAST) to facilitate self-management of fire ants in the suppression area. Commencing as soon as possible, FAST plans to undertake two aerial treatments of approximately 106,000 hectares of known high infestations within the suppression area before 30 June 2026.
